Parallel training (Sec. 5.1 in [ArcFace](https://arxiv.org/pdf/1801.07698v3.pdf)) can highly speed up training as well as reduce consumption of GPU memory. Here are some results. | Parallel Method | Float Type | Backbone | GPU | Batch Size | FC Size | Split FC? | Avg. Throughput (images/sec) | Memory (MiB) | | --- | --- | --- | --- | --- | --- | --- | --- | --- | | DP | FP32 | iResNet50 | v100 x 8 | 512 | 85742 | No | 1099.41 | 8681 | | DDP | FP32 | iResNet50 | v100 x 8 | 512 | 85742 | **Yes** | 1687.71 | 8137 | | DDP | FP16 | iResNet50 | v100 x 8 | 512 | 85742 | **Yes** | 3388.66 | 5629 | | DP | FP32 | iResNet100 | v100 x 8 | 512 | 85742 | No | 612.40 | 11825 | | DDP | FP32 | iResNet100 | v100 x 8 | 512 | 85742 | **Yes** | 1060.16 | 10777 | | DDP | FP16 | iResNet100 | v100 x 8 | 512 | 85742 | **Yes** | 2013.90 | 7319 | ## Logs TODO list: - [x] add toy examples and release models - [x] migrate basic codes from the private codebase - [x] add beamer (after the ddl for iccv2021) - [x] test the basic codes - [ ] add presentation - [x] migrate parallel training - [ ] release mpu (Kaiyu Yue, in April) - [x] test parallel training - [ ] add evaluation codes for recognition - [ ] add evaluation codes for quality assessment - [x] add fp16 - [ ] test fp16 - [ ] extend the idea to CosFace **20210331** test fp32 + parallel training and release a model/log **20210325.2** add codes for parallel training as well as fp16 training (not tested). **20210325** the basic training codes are tested!
